Driveway curb construction involves creating a defined border along the edges of a driveway, typically made from concrete, brick, or stone. This border helps to clearly separate the driveway from surrounding landscaping or walkways, providing a clean, finished look. Proper curb construction not only enhances the overall appearance of a property but also helps to prevent soil, gravel, or debris from spreading onto the driveway surface. It’s an important step in establishing a durable and visually appealing driveway that can stand up to daily use and weather conditions.
This service is especially helpful for addressing common driveway problems such as cracking, settling, or uneven edges. Over time, driveways may develop cracks or become uneven due to ground shifting or heavy vehicle traffic. Installing a sturdy curb can help contain the driveway material, preventing erosion and further damage. Additionally, curb construction can improve drainage by guiding water away from the driveway and toward designated areas, reducing the risk of puddles, pooling, or water damage that could compromise the driveway’s integrity.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Curb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waxhaw,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way curb repairs in Waxhaw range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Basic Curb Installation - Installing new driveway curbs usually costs between $1,200 and $2,500 for most local projects. Larger or more complex installations may reach $3,500 or more, but most jobs stay within the middle tier.
Full Curb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of driveway curbs can range from $3,000 to $7,000+, with many projects landing in the $4,000-$6,000 range based on size and materials used.
Custom or Decorative Curbing - Specialized or decorative driveway curbs often cost $2,500 to $5,000 or higher. These projects are less common and tend to be at the upper end of the typical cost sp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are driveway curb construction services? Driveway curb construction involves building or installing concrete or stone borders along the edges of a driveway to define its boundaries and enhance curb appeal.
Why should someone consider driveway curb construction? Adding a curb can improve the appearance of a property, help contain gravel or paving materials, and provide a clear boundary for the driveway area.
What materials are commonly used for driveway curbs? Common materials include concrete, stone, brick, and precast concrete blocks, chosen based on style preferences and durability needs.
How do local contractors typically handle driveway curb projects? They assess the site, prepare the foundation, and construct the curb using selected materials, ensuring proper alignment and stability.
Can driveway curb construction be customized to match existing landscaping? Yes, contractors can tailor curb designs, materials, and finishes to complement the property's existing landscaping and aesthetic preferences.
